The Vehicle Edge Detection Based on Homomorphism Filtering and Fuzzy Enhancement in Night-time Environments

This article presents a novel vehicle edge detection algorithm based on Canny operator in nighttime environment. Firstly, spatial homomorphism filtering is used to eliminate the illuminating influence; then an improved self-adaptive fuzzy enhancement Canny operator is used to enhance the vehicle edge; lastly the maximum classification square error method is used to calculate the dual threshold, performing the vehicle edge detection. Experiments indicate that this method eliminates the interference from the auto lamps, well applicable for the vehicle edge detection in the night-time environment.
